In recent years, the healthcare industry has witnessed a significant shift towards biopharmaceuticals, or bio pharma. This emerging field combines biology and pharmaceuticals to develop drugs that are derived from living organisms, such as proteins, antibodies, and vaccines. bio pharma companies are at the forefront of innovation, driving advancements in personalized medicine, gene therapy, and immunotherapy. As a result, they are revolutionizing the way we treat and cure diseases.
The rapid growth of bio pharma can be attributed to several factors. First and foremost, advancements in biotechnology have provided researchers with the tools and techniques needed to develop complex biologic drugs. These drugs are designed to target specific molecular pathways involved in disease progression, resulting in more precise and effective treatments. In addition, the increasing prevalence of chronic and complex diseases, such as cancer, diabetes, and autoimmune disorders, has created a demand for innovative therapies that can address unmet medical needs.
One of the key advantages of bio pharma drugs is their ability to be tailored to individual patients based on their genetic makeup and disease profile. This personalized approach, known as precision medicine, allows for more targeted and effective treatments, minimizing side effects and optimizing therapeutic outcomes. For example, immunotherapy drugs are designed to stimulate the body’s immune system to recognize and attack cancer cells, leading to higher response rates and improved survival rates in patients with certain types of cancer.
Another area where bio pharma is making a significant impact is in the field of gene therapy. Gene therapy involves introducing genetic material into cells to correct faulty genes or provide missing proteins, offering the potential to treat genetic disorders and inherited diseases. Recent advancements in gene editing technologies, such as CRISPR-Cas9, have accelerated the development of gene therapy treatments, bringing new hope to patients with previously untreatable conditions.
In addition to personalized medicine and gene therapy, bio pharma companies are also focusing on the development of novel biologics, such as monoclonal antibodies and fusion proteins. These drugs are designed to target specific molecules in the body that are involved in disease processes, providing more effective and safer alternatives to traditional small molecule drugs. For example, bi-specific antibodies can simultaneously target two different antigens on cancer cells, leading to enhanced immune response and improved treatment outcomes.

Despite the promising outlook for bio pharma, the industry faces several challenges that must be addressed to sustain its growth momentum. Regulatory hurdles, such as the approval process for biologic drugs and gene therapy treatments, can be lengthy and costly, requiring companies to navigate complex regulatory pathways to bring their products to market. In addition, competition among bio pharma companies is intensifying, as new entrants enter the market with innovative therapies and technologies.
To stay competitive in this rapidly evolving landscape, bio pharma companies must continue to invest in research and development to drive innovation and differentiation. Collaborations with academic institutions, research organizations, and other industry partners can help accelerate the discovery and development of new treatments, while strategic partnerships and licensing deals can provide access to cutting-edge technologies and expertise. In addition, investing in manufacturing capabilities and supply chain optimization is essential to ensure the timely delivery of biologic drugs to patients in need.
